What are selective agents?

The Selective Agent is the environmental factor acting on the population. The Selection Pressure is the effect of Natural Selection acting on the population. … Selection Pressure -The organisms that are better suited to their environment survive the pressure of selective agents.

What is the selecting agent in artificial selection?

In artificial selection the experimenter chooses specific phenotypic traits to select upon while in controlled natural selection an environmental factor is manipulated and evolution of the populations in response to this selective agent is monitored.

What are four different selective agents?

Resource availability – Presence of sufficient food habitat (shelter / territory) and mates. Environmental conditions – Temperature weather conditions or geographical access. Biological factors – Predators and pathogens (diseases)

What is a selective force example?

A selective pressure is any reason for organisms with certain phenotypes to have either a survival benefit or disadvantage. In the example above strong sunlight is a selective pressure that favors darker-skinned people lighter skin would be a disadvantage in these regions.

Are Predators selecting agents?

Predation is a particularly important selective agent which may drastically affect fitness and is known to have shaped many traits in prey organisms (e.g. Mikolajewski et al. … Many phenotypic traits may underlie this whole-organism performance measure and therefore experience such survival selection.

What is natural selection Bioninja?

Natural selection is the change in the composition of a gene pool in response to a differentially selective environmental pressure. The frequency of one particular phenotype in relation to another will be a product of the type of selection that is occurring.

What are the five types of selective pressures?

There are several ways selection can affect population variation: stabilizing selection directional selection diversifying selection frequency-dependent selection and sexual selection.

What are the 5 parts of natural selection?

Natural selection is a simple mechanism that causes populations of living things to change over time. In fact it is so simple that it can be broken down into five basic steps abbreviated here as VISTA: Variation Inheritance Selection Time and Adaptation.

What are 3 types of selective breeding?

The three methods of selective breeding are outcrossing inbreeding and line breeding.
